Range-extended new energy vehicles are a type of automobile that combines the advantages of electric vehicles and internal combustion engines (Shi et al. in Mech Syst Signal Process 179, 2022). These vehicles typically use an electric motor as the main propulsion system (Hossain et al. in J Energy Storage 55:105752, 2022), equipped with a small internal combustion engine (usually gasoline or diesel). Under normal conditions, the vehicle primarily relies on battery power, driven by the electric motor, which offers high efficiency and low emissions. When the battery charge drops to a certain level, the internal combustion engine starts and acts as a generator to recharge the battery (Wang et al. in J Power Sources 521, 2022).
